CM wants last mile service delivery to people

Bhubaneswar, October 28, 2017: Chief Minister Naveen Patnaik on Saturday asked
the Secretaries, Heads of Departments and district Collectors to give their
best in providing the last mile service delivery to the people of the State.

“People are at the centre of governance. Collectors are at
the cutting edge of delivery of public services. I am sure that Secretaries,
Heads of Departments and Collectors present in today’s conference will give
their best in providing the last minute delivery to the people of the State,”
said Patnaik while gracing the one-day Collector’ conference here at the State
Secretariat.
Maintaining that in the last Collector’s workshop held in
June, 2017, he had stressed upon improving service delivery to the common
people through 3Ts – Technology, Teamwork and Transparency, Patnaik said Secretaries
have been advised to visit the districts for four days during the first week of
every month to streamline execution of development initiatives.
“Priority programmes and schemes of the Government, which are
being discussed in the today’s Conference, shall be inspected in the field by
the Secretaries methodically. To ensure proper implementation of schemes and
programmes of the Government and to ensure actual delivery of services to the
people, it is important that other supervisory officers right from the Heads of
Departments to Block Level Extension functionaries make intensive field
visits,” added the Chief Minister.
The Collectors’ conference discussed on implementation and
status of 12 major welfare schemes and projects like Mamata, Biju Pucca Ghar
Yojana, Cluster Bore Well, Mission Shakti, Niramaya, Nirman Shramik Kalyan
Yojana, Drinking Water, Rural Electrification, Public Distribution System
(PDS),  old-age pension scheme, Sarva Sikshya
Abhiyan and Integrated Child development Scheme (ICDS).
Almost all the district Collectors, Chief Secretary Aditya
Prasad Padhi, Development Commissioner R Balkrishnan among Secretaries of
various departments attended the conference.
